Resonating Reflections: A Mother's Unspoken Legacy

In the quiet town of Willowbrook, beneath the sprawling branches of the old oak tree that stood at the heart of the family estate, young Thomas had spent countless afternoons listening to the whispers of the wind. It was here that his mother, Elspeth, had shared her dreams and fears, her laughter and tears. But as the years passed, the stories grew hushed, and the whispers of the wind seemed to carry the weight of unspoken words.

Thomas, now a man in his late thirties, had always felt a strange disconnect from his mother. She was a woman of few words, her presence a gentle force that seemed to fill the room with a quiet strength. It was only after her passing that he realized the depth of her influence on his life, a legacy that was as much about what was said as what was unsaid.

The turning point came when Thomas unearthed an old, leather-bound journal hidden beneath the floorboards of the attic. The journal was filled with entries that spoke of love, loss, and the unyielding strength of the human spirit. Each page was a testament to Elspeth's life, a life that had been lived in the shadows of the public eye, a life that had been shaped by the echoes of love.

In the first entry, Elspeth wrote of her own mother, a woman who had raised her alone after the death of her husband. It was a story of resilience, of a mother who had worked tirelessly to provide for her daughter, instilling in her the values of hard work and compassion. The echoes of that love were clear, resonating through Elspeth's own life as she raised her son alone.

The journal then chronicled Elspeth's own experiences, her struggles, and her triumphs. She spoke of the love she had found in unexpected places, the sacrifices she had made, and the joy she found in the smallest of moments. It was a love that had been tested by time and adversity, yet it had never wavered.

As Thomas delved deeper into the journal, he discovered a story that was not his own. It was the story of a woman who had loved deeply, who had lost much, and who had found solace in the love of her son. The entries spoke of her fears for his future, her hopes for his happiness, and her silent prayers for his well-being.

One entry in particular stood out. It was a letter to Thomas, written on the eve of his graduation. In it, Elspeth expressed her pride in his achievements but also her concern for his future. She spoke of the world outside the estate, a world that was vast and unpredictable. She reminded him that life would not always be kind, but that he had the strength to face it.

It was in this moment that Thomas understood the true meaning of his mother's legacy. It was not just the stories she had told him, but the unspoken ones that had shaped him into the man he was. The echoes of love that had filled his childhood home were now a guiding force, a reminder of the love that had sustained him through the years.

The journal became a touchstone for Thomas, a reminder of the love that had been his mother's legacy. It was a legacy that he carried with him, a legacy that he would pass on to his own children one day. It was a legacy that taught him that love, like the whispers of the wind, could be heard in the quietest of moments, and that it was a force that could never be truly lost.

As Thomas sat beneath the old oak tree, the journal open in his lap, he felt a profound connection to his mother. He understood that the echoes of love were not just the words she had spoken, but the actions she had taken, the sacrifices she had made, and the love she had given unconditionally. It was a love that would continue to resonate through generations, a love that would never fade.

In the end, Thomas realized that the true power of the echoes of love was not in the words, but in the actions they inspired. It was in the love he would give to his own children, and in the love that would be passed on to them, and to their children after them. The echoes of love were a timeless melody, a song that would be sung forever, a song that would never be forgotten.
